2004 ram 1500 with 5.7 hemi. When the temp is below about 40 degrees the truck starts fine first thing in the morning. Then travel about a half hour so the engine is up to temp. Then I shut the truck off and let it cool down for about half an hour to an hour. When I start the truck again it has a rough idle and a very bad hesitation. I can't get over 2000 rpms. The truck will jerk and spit and sputter. Sometimes I can hear what sounds like a backfire. The all of a sudden it seems like it clears itself out and runs fine. I just put in a new egr valve and cleaned the tb. Any help would be appreciated.
